Output 7bd59091c6fe22b9018dd4e9aeb9991e10c77cf3dc3b167e3ec303c1c99ee128:2

value
45064792
script pubkey
OP_0 OP_PUSHBYTES_20 efc4bcd4e6ab8dc8e356146954549d0add06f798
address
bc1qalzte48x4wxu3c6kz354g4yaptwsdaucm4jgne
transaction
7bd59091c6fe22b9018dd4e9aeb9991e10c77cf3dc3b167e3ec303c1c99ee128
spent
true